c) The value on the display is fluorescence level in the
process. If the sample is the background material, this is
your background fluorescence level.
d) Insert the span filter using the SPN CHK button located
on the upper end of the Fluorometer housing. When the
filter is in place, the FLTR-IN LED will change from
green to red. Refer to Figure 3-1.
e) See page 18 for discussion on span filter.
f) Both the REF and MSR DET LEDs should have solid
green or flashing green output.
g) If the indicator LED color does change color, refer to the
Diagnostics section below.
h) Depress the SPN CHK button to remove the filter from
the beam path. The FLTR-IN indicator will change from
red to green.
i) Wait 2 minutes for the output to stabilize and the unit
should display the background fluorescence level.
j) Both the REF and MSR DET LEDs should have solid
green or flashing green output.
k) The unit is now ready for process monitoring.
3) There is no need to adjust the 4mA and 20 mA levels for process
monitoring, since the presence of analyte will move the
fluorescence level upward from the background level.
4) Instructions for adjusting the 4mA, 20 mA and display levels are
given below.

Case 3: Process monitoring following
application engineering
This case is valid when the user has determined that Mode 2
monitoring is sufficient to meet the monitoring goals in process. This is
the simplest monitoring method since no calibration standard is
required.
